Commercial Building Construction Schedule Example: A Phased Approach



The following example outlines a typical schedule for a mid-sized commercial building project (approximately 20,000 square feet). Remember, this is a sample and will vary significantly based on project complexity, location, and specific requirements.

Phase 1: Pre-Construction (4-6 Weeks)



Site Investigation & Analysis (1 Week): Soil testing, surveying, and utility location.
Design Development & Permits (3 Weeks): Finalizing architectural plans, engineering drawings, and obtaining necessary permits.
Contractor Selection & Contracts (2 Weeks): Bidding process, contract negotiation, and finalizing agreements with subcontractors.


Phase 2: Site Work (8-12 Weeks)



Site Clearing & Preparation (2 Weeks): Removing existing structures, grading, and excavating.
Foundation Construction (4 Weeks): Pouring footings, foundation walls, and slab.
Utility Installation (2 Weeks): Connecting water, sewer, gas, and electricity lines.


Phase 3: Building Construction (20-24 Weeks)



Framing (4 Weeks): Erection of structural steel or wood framing.
Roofing (2 Weeks): Installation of roofing materials and flashing.
Exterior Walls & Cladding (4 Weeks): Brick, concrete, or other exterior wall systems.
Interior Finishes (6 Weeks): Drywall, painting, flooring, and ceiling installation.
MEP (Mechanical, Electrical, Plumbing) Installation (4 Weeks): HVAC systems, electrical wiring, plumbing fixtures.


Phase 4: Final Stages (4-6 Weeks)



Fixture Installation (2 Weeks): Installation of light fixtures, plumbing fixtures, and other interior elements.
Landscaping (2 Weeks): Grading, planting, and other landscaping work.
Final Inspections & Handover (2 Weeks): Completion of all inspections and official handover to the client.


Critical Path Analysis: Identifying Bottlenecks



Critical path analysis is essential for efficient scheduling. It identifies the sequence of tasks that determines the shortest possible project duration. Any delays in these critical path activities will directly impact the overall project timeline. In our example, foundation construction, framing, and MEP installation are likely to be critical path activities. Careful planning and resource allocation are crucial for these phases.


Software and Tools for Commercial Construction Scheduling



Several software tools are available to help manage complex construction schedules. Popular options include Microsoft Project, Primavera P6, and various cloud-based project management platforms. These tools offer features such as Gantt charts, resource allocation, and progress tracking, enabling efficient project management.
